I honestly didn't understand the Taggert hire at the time.
Oct 29, 2018, 11:04 AM
|
|
FSU is one of the premier jobs in the country. They could have had basically any coach in the country. They picked Taggart, who was seemingly well thought of, but the results just weren't there for me. He went 16-20 at Western Kentucky, 24-25 at South Florida, and 7-5 at Oregon. Don't get me wrong, he seemed to do a good job of building up Western Kentucky and restoring USF, but he left before huge success ever came, and we don't really know if he can lead a team to even conference titles, let alone national titles. To date, his biggest accomplishment is sharing a division title with Temple (losing the tiebreaker) and making it to the Birmingham Bowl. He's never coached a won game in his life.
Taggert could end up proving to be a good hire, but, for me, it was certainly a much riskier hire than FSU needed to make.

He’s a good guy but in over his head . Was likelinin over his head at Oregon too but not there long enough for it play out. attended a couple of his practices at USF when he held HS coaches clinics and it was an absolute unorganized fire drill. I don’t believe he will support the past culture of behavior in Tallahassee but as noted is a great recruiter and knows the State of Florida well. The rising success of the Gators, UCF going to New Years Day bowls , and Clemson still pilfring top talent from the Sunshine State will make life hard for him. Also for now, Richt appears to be locking down S Florida for the U. And Charley Strong at USF is loved by HS coaches across the State. It’s going to take him a while so he better hope Chief Osceola is patient
